Now a days, browsing the internet can be dangerous for your computer. Every time you visit a website, that website could send you all kinds of nasty bugs or steal information from your computer. Even trusted websites can not be trusted anymore because of the ads they display or the third party scripts they use for tracking users. Websites have a hard time controlling their advertisers. Hackers love to hide horrible surprises inside of ads, and steal all of your personal information using scripts. With IMVU's HP customization system, it practically turns their entire site into a cross site scripting / injection nightmare. Here are some internet browser add-ons that our staff recommends for protecting yourself against hackers on IMVU.

Script Blockers - these block known malicious JavaScript scripts that try to track, fingerprint, and steal your personal information. You have the option of individually allowing each site you visit to run scripts, giving you control over which scripts are ran in your internet browser. Warning, script blockers might break a website till you tell the script blocker to allow scrips on that site.

Ad Blockers - these prevent annoying and often dangerous ads from displaying on webpages.

Ad Block Hiders - these hide your ad blocker, so sites can not tell you to turn to off your ad-blocker, leaving you vulnurable to ads.

Referer Controllers - this prevents websites from tracking your browser history. It allows you to list sites that you do not want tracking where you have been and where you are going.

Mobile Chromium Browsers That support addons:
If you are on mobile, then you can install Yandex or Kiwi as your browser; which are versions of Chrome mobile that support the addons listed in the opening post.
Simply search Yandex or Kiwi in the app store, install the browser, and then install the Chrome addons listed above.
